1

Senior Java Developer Jobs in West Virginia (NOW HIRING)

Senior Subject Matter Expert - PEGA

Clarksburg, WV · On-site

$120K - $158K/yr

We are seeking a Senior Level Software Engineer to design, build, test and maintain scalable ... Expertise in backend development in one or more programming languages is required. * Java * Spring ...

Senior Software Engineer

Morgantown, WV · On-site +1

$87K - $157K/yr

... Senior Software Engineers with 4+ years of hands-on experience to join our dynamic team. The ... Hands-on experience with Java/C++ and object-oriented programming (applicants will be tested)

You will act as a trusted advisor, combining hands-on technical expertise (Java and Python) with ... This role requires both strong engineering depth and the ability to translate complex identity ...

Senior Software Engineer II

Charleston, WV · On-site +1

$197K - $232K/yr

One Data Streaming Platform. About the Role Senior Software Engineers II at Confluent take ... Deep proficiency in at least one major backend programming language (for example, Java, Go, C/C ...

... Go, Java, or Swift. Excellent writing and grammar skills. A bachelor's degree (completed or in progress). Previous experience as a Software Developer, Coder, Software Engineer, or Programmer is ...

$150K - $180K/yr

We are looking for a Senior Site Reliability to join our dynamic and growing Platform Engineering ... Proficiency with at least one programming language used for automation (e.g., Python, Go, or Java ...

$41.75 - $56.50/hr

Web Specialist * .Net, SharePoint, HTML, java script, VB script * Ability to create and modify ... E. Business Intelligence Architect / OLAP Developer * Demonstrated ability to deliver solutions ...

$150K - $200K/yr

Write clean, maintainable, and efficient code in TypeScript and Java. * Optimize applications for ... Experience with CI/CD pipelines and DevOps practices. * Experience with AI-enhanced UI/UX design ...

$150K - $180K/yr

Write clean, maintainable, and efficient code in TypeScript and Java. * Optimize applications for ... Experience with CI/CD pipelines and DevOps practices. * Experience with AI-enhanced UI/UX design ...

Work with Product Management, DevOps, Data Science, QA, and other engineering teams to align ... Node.js, Java, Go, or Python) * Experience with API gateways, load balancing, caching, and ...

Technical breadth and depth Strong working knowledge across multiple stacks, including Java/J2EE ... developer experience Leadership as a senior IC Proven ability to influence without authority ...

Technical breadth and depth Strong working knowledge across multiple stacks, including Java/J2EE ... developer experience Leadership as a senior IC Proven ability to influence without authority ...

next page

Showing results 1-20

Senior Java Developer information

See West Virginia salary details

$8

$48

$66

How much do senior java developer jobs pay per hour?

As of Jun 5, 2026, the average hourly pay for senior java developer in West Virginia is $48.64, according to ZipRecruiter salary data. Most workers in this role earn between $42.60 and $54.33 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Senior Java Developer, and why are they important?

To thrive as a Senior Java Developer, you need advanced proficiency in Java programming, experience with software design patterns, and a strong grasp of backend development, often supported by a degree in computer science or related field. Familiarity with frameworks like Spring, build tools such as Maven or Gradle, and version control systems like Git, as well as knowledge of cloud platforms, is typically required. Excellent problem-solving, leadership, and communication skills help you guide teams and collaborate effectively. These competencies are crucial for delivering robust, scalable software solutions and driving technical success within development teams.

What are some common challenges Senior Java Developers face when working on large-scale enterprise projects?

Senior Java Developers often encounter challenges such as maintaining code quality across large codebases, managing dependencies between modules, and ensuring optimal application performance. Collaborating with cross-functional teams—including QA, DevOps, and product management—requires clear communication and effective problem-solving. Additionally, staying updated with the latest Java frameworks and best practices is essential for delivering scalable and maintainable solutions in complex enterprise environments.

What are Senior Java Developers?

Senior Java Developers are experienced software engineers who specialize in using the Java programming language to design, develop, and maintain complex applications. They typically lead development teams, oversee project architecture, and ensure code quality through best practices. In addition to strong coding skills, they often mentor junior developers and collaborate with stakeholders to deliver robust software solutions. Their expertise is crucial in building scalable, high-performance applications across various industries.

What is the difference between Senior Java Developer vs Java Software Engineer?

AspectSenior Java DeveloperJava Software Engineer
Required CredentialsBachelor's in CS or related, Java certifications often preferredBachelor's in CS or related, Java certifications beneficial
Work EnvironmentTeam lead roles, project management, mentoringDevelopment-focused, coding, testing, and implementation
Employer & Industry UsageTech companies, finance, e-commerceSoftware firms, startups, enterprise IT
Common Search & ComparisonOften compared for experience level and responsibilitiesSimilar roles with slight variations in scope

The main difference between a Senior Java Developer and a Java Software Engineer lies in their responsibilities and experience. Senior Java Developers typically take on leadership, mentoring, and project management roles, while Java Software Engineers focus more on coding, development, and technical implementation. Both roles require strong Java skills and relevant credentials, but the Senior Java Developer usually has more experience and a broader scope of responsibilities.

What are the most commonly searched types of Java Developer jobs in West Virginia? The most popular types of Java Developer jobs in West Virginia are:
What are popular job titles related to Senior Java Developer jobs in West Virginia? For Senior Java Developer jobs in West Virginia, the most frequently searched job titles are:
What job categories do people searching Senior Java Developer jobs in West Virginia look for? The top searched job categories for Senior Java Developer jobs in West Virginia are:
What cities in West Virginia are hiring for Senior Java Developer jobs? Cities in West Virginia with the most Senior Java Developer job openings:
What are popular job titles related to Senior Java Developer jobs in WV? For Senior Java Developer jobs in WV, the most frequently searched job titles are:
Senior Subject Matter Expert - PEGA

Senior Subject Matter Expert - PEGA

Leidos

Clarksburg, WV • On-site

$120K - $158K/yr

Full-time

Posted 12 days ago


Leidos rating

8.4

Company rating: 8.4 out of 10

Based on 146 frontline employees who took The Breakroom Quiz

56th of 425 rated business services


Job description

We are seeking a Senior Level Software Engineer to design, build, test and maintain scalable software systems. This role will play a part in performing ongoing development and operational sustainment for a large IT system with stringent service level agreements and data management constraints.

The ideal candidate has experience in utilizing Pega Business Orchestration and Automation Technology (BOAT) in the development and sustainment of systems. A demonstrated ability with cloud-native architectures, testing, and modern CI/CD practices and tools, while also being comfortable contributing across the full stack when needed. Duties include computer programming, documenting, managing configuration, testing, and bug fixing involved in creating and maintaining applications and frameworks involved in a software release life cycle and resulting in a software product.

Key Responsibilities:

  • Apply Pega Business Orchestration and Automation Technology in the on-going development and operational sustainment of large, complex IT systems.

  • Participate in Agile ceremonies including sprint planning, standups, retrospectives, and PI planning events.

  • Responsible for performing software engineering functions, including design, development, testing, troubleshooting, and debugging software programs for enhancements and new software-intensive systems.

  • Applies appropriate principles, standards, processes, procedures and tools throughout the software development life cycle.

  • Influences development of solutions that impact strategic project/program goals and business results.

  • Recommends and develops new technical solutions, products, and/or standards in support of functions' strategy and operations.

  • Lead and manage the work of other technical staff that has significant impact on project results/outputs.

  • Resolves highly complex problems using significant application of technical knowledge, conceptualization, reasoning and interpretation.

  • Develops solutions that are highly innovative and achieved through research and integration of best practices.

  • Requires ability to communicate with executive leadership (internally or client) regarding matters of significant importance to the organization/project.

  • Has in-depth understanding of technical principles, theories, concepts and their application.

  • Serves as a subject matter expert within technical domain area.

  • Design and develop scalable backend services, APIs, and microservices.

  • Collaborate with product managers, designers, customers, and engineers to deliver new features.

  • Write clean, maintainable, well-tested code following best practices.

  • Review code and mentor junior engineers.

  • Optimize applications for performance, scalability, and reliability.

  • Support CI/CD pipelines and cloud infrastructure for application.

  • Assist with troubleshooting production issues and implement long-term solutions.

Required Qualifications:

  • Typically requires BS degree and 12 - 15 years of prior relevant experience or Master's with 10 - 13 years of prior relevant experience. May possess a Doctorate in a technical domain.

  • Expertise in Pega Business Orchestration and Automation Technology is required.

  • Expertise in backend development in one or more programming languages is required.

    • Java

    • Spring Boot

    • Automated testing experience in end-to-end testing, regression testing, integration testing, etc.

  • Experience in Lean-Agile development, Agile IT project management, planning, metrics review events.

  • Experience with Agile project management software such as Jira, Confluence, etc.

  • Knowledge of working with relational databases (Oracle, PostgreSQL, MySQL, etc.)

  • Experience with cloud platforms such as AWS, Azure, or Google Cloud.

  • Familiarity with containerization technologies like Docker and Kubernetes.

  • Experience with version control systems such as Git.

  • Experience with CI/CD pipelines such as Gitlab.

  • Knowledge of software architecture, design patterns, and system scalability.

  • Must hold active Secret security clearance.

Preferred Qualifications:

  • Experience with frontend frameworks (React, Angular, or Vue).

  • One or more Pega Systems certifications (e.g.: Pega Systems Architect, Pega Senior Systems Architect).

  • Experience integrating Artificial Intelligence (AI) and Machine Learning (ML) into IT systems for enhanced performance and functionality.

  • Experience building RESTful APIs and microservices interfaces.

  • Knowledge of infrastructure-as-code (IaC) tools (Hashicorp Terraform, CloudFormation, Ansible).

  • Experience with observability tools (Datadog, Prometheus, Grafana, CloudWatch, Elastic Search).

  • Automated testing with SmartBear SoapUI and Selenium/Zalenium.

  • A working knowledge and experience with the following are preferred as they will be used to complete Software Engineering tasks: SAFe 6, Git, Kubernetes, Docker, Linux, SQL Developer, Jira, GitLab, Java, Spring, Maven, NEIM XML, EBTS.

Key Competencies:

  • Problem-solving and analytical thinking.

  • Passion for quality control and improving engineering practices.

  • Excellent communication and collaboration skills.

  • Ownership mindset and accountability for deliverables.

If you're looking for comfort, keep scrolling. At Leidos, we outthink, outbuild, and outpace the status quo - because the mission demands it. We're not hiring followers. We're recruiting the ones who disrupt, provoke, and refuse to fail. Step 10 is ancient history. We're already at step 30 - and moving faster than anyone else dares.

Original Posting:April 23, 2026

For U.S. Positions: While subject to change based on business needs, Leidos reasonably anticipates that this job requisition will remain open for at least 3 days with an anticipated close date of no earlier than 3 days after the original posting date as listed above.

Pay Range:Pay Range $131,300.00 - $237,350.00

The Leidos pay range for this job level is a general guideline onlyand not a guarantee of compensation or salary. Additional factors considered in extending an offer include (but are not limited to) responsibilities of the job, education, experience, knowledge, skills, and abilities, as well as internal equity, alignment with market data, applicable bargaining agreement (if any), or other law.


What Leidos employ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om


Leidos logo

About Leidos

Sourced by ZipRecruiter

At Leidos, we deliver innovative solutions through the efforts of our diverse and talented people who are dedicated to our customers' success. We empower our teams, contribute to our communities, and operate sustainable practices. Everything we do is built on a commitment to do the right thing for our customers, our people, and our community.

Industry

It services

Company size

10,000+ Employees

Headquarters location

Reston, VA, US

Social media